Staff Report
NEW MIAMI — Austin Morgan scored 21 points and Steven Rogers added 11 on Tuesday night as New Miami High School’s boys basketball team put up a good fight before losing to visiting Taylor 51-41.
Dylan Lee’s 20 points paced the Yellow Jackets (5-14). The Vikings fell to 1-18.
Harrison 58, Ross 41: The host Wildcats nailed eight of their 12 treys in the second half and pulled away for the Fort Ancient Valley Conference West Division win.
Max Mischkulnig (14) and Brandon Fernandez (10) were the top scorers for the Rams (13-6 overall, 9-4 FAVC). Harrison improved to 9-10, 6-7.
Mount Healthy 50, Talawanda 30: The visiting Braves scored just 10 points in the first half and fell to 7-12 overall and 5-8 in the FAVC West. The Owls are 9-10, 7-6.
Nolan Robinson had seven points and five rebounds for THS.
Northwest 78, Edgewood 41: The visiting Cougars jumped to an 11-2 lead, then got steamrolled by the Knights.
Mason Back had 12 points for Edgewood, which dropped to 1-18 overall and 1-12 in the FAVC West. Northwest is 12-7, 10-3.
Bowling
Indians win GMC title: Fairfield’s girls bowling team completed an unbeaten regular season Monday, rolling past Lakota East 2,396-1,343 at Fairfield Lanes.
Heather Scott’s 221-192—413 series led the Indians, who won the outright Greater Miami Conference title with a 9-0 mark and were 18-0 overall.
